About UsHaworth is one of the world's largest manufacturers of office furniture, providing solutions for tomorrow's customers worldwide. At the centre of our work is the human being: What does a person need to work, what pushes them, motivates them and what makes people feel comfortable at work? Only if we can answer that question, we are able to introduce designs to our customers that will make them achieve their goals. To stay one step ahead, we invest in our own research, have a worldwide network of interesting partners and are part of think tanks around the world who are trying to think ahead. The family-owned company, headquartered in Holland, Michigan/United States, employs more than 8,000 people and is represented in more than 150 countries in Asia, Europe and America with subsidiaries and partners.
